Home Towned?: UofA at A&M


I think the fix was in during the Cats visit to College Station. I'm not saying that this is an excuse. Chase should have hit that shot especially since they were able to get the ball back to him once he gave it up. Why doesn't he like having the ball for the entire position? It always seems like he needs to get the ball off of a screen.

Other problems:

Fogg and Hill have to hit free throws.
Jamelle Horne should never be in the game during the final shot. He got lost on a switch with Johnson and let the three point specialist have an open look.

That being said....

There was one stretch in the game that initiated the A&M run and the entire sequence was assisted by the refs. With 6.5 minutes left in the game the Cats are up 9. Wise gets called for his 5th foul even though he landed in a jump-stop and the defender used his arms to launch off. Then Chase is called for throwing the ball out of bounds even though it was clearly knocked out from behind and finally Hill gets T'd for verbally responding to a provocation by an Aggie.

Want more evidence:

The Aggies shot 7 more free throws
The Cats had 10 more turnovers (many of them foul induced I would argue)
The Cats had 5 more fouls

The good news is the Cats looked great. When we have 2 of the big three we can hold our own. With 3 of 3 we are tough. Zane Johnson as I predicted hit some big shots and we significantly out rebounded them.
